Have been checking out the "Clearview" range of towing mirrors which are designed to replace the existing mirrors with minor mechanical knowledge and work off the vehicle's current electrical loom. I have looked at this system on other 4 X 4's and am relatively pleased at the ease of fitting. Price - hmm! At $795.00 per pair (self installed) or and extra $110.00 (installation by ARB) I consider the price somewhat over the top but the alternatives are clumsy and near useless!

We have decided to go with the "Clearview" option and will report back on the outcome!

Well, surprise - surprise! Now have checked out another site which I stumbled upon. Adventure Towing - Craigieburn Victoria, They supply similar to Clearview but $200 cheaper and free delivery. One choice only as no Chrome and indicators whether you need them or not. For me a perfect combination and delivered to my door in two working days - sorry Clearview, time to be more competitive. Installing tomorrow, appears simple enough!

OK, have installed the new mirrors, very easy, took about 15 minutes all up! Indicators work fine but the electric adjustment not working at all. Going through the process with the supplier to try to sort out!
